Output 0665b67282b88204567ef1d504572bc6b526137c21e7aeb0266ed8fbff264932:42

value
673792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0b3c7ee595db5d52cd934cd78840f4950b530ce OP_EQUAL
address
MRU5LfR73FzqAwz2iDMx8h7SJjCK4Hwwxs
transaction
0665b67282b88204567ef1d504572bc6b526137c21e7aeb0266ed8fbff264932
spent
true